“…These measurements yielded the precise values of the integral cosmic ray muon flux at the location of Belgrade. Measured muon flux is: 137(6) m -2 s -1 at the ground level and 45(2) m -2 s -1 at the underground level [4]. Different analyses of time series of these measurements have also been performed.…”
